SK Telecom Launches Commercial LTE-Advanced Network
South Korea’s wireless operator SK Telecom has debuted the LTE-Advanced (LTE-A) service through smartphones. To commercialize LTE-A, SK Telecom has already applied Carrier Aggregation (CA) and Coordinated Multi Point (CoMP), and plans to apply Enhanced Inter-Cell Interference Coordination (eICIC) in 2014.
Nokia Siemens Networks Achieve 56 Mbps Peak Upload Throughput in TD-LTE
Nokia Siemens Networks has announced that it has achieved 56 Mbps peak upload throughput in a TD-LTE network using its commercial 4G base station with multiple antenna technology and a single 20 MHz carrier.
915 Million LTE Subscribers Globally by the End of 2016
Analysts IDATE predicts more than 915 million LTE subscriptions worldwide by the end of 2016 and expects first billion to be exceeded during 2017. Asia-Pacific is expected to represent a sizeable 41.6% of the total, North America 21.6%, Africa/Middle East 7.5%, Eastern Europe 4.9% and Western Europe 15.8%.

SIMalliance Publishes New LTE UICC Profile for Mobile Operators
SIMalliance has published an updated technical document for mobile network operators (MNOs) that specifies the integrated features required to provide optimal UICC support for LTE network and IMS services deployment.

ABI Research: 500M LTE-Advanced Subscriptions by the End of 2018
The LTE-Advanced (LTE-A) subscriptions will take an important role in the mobile subscriber market,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 295% between 2013 and 2018 to reach 500 million, reports ABI Research. It will represent 34% of the overall 1.47 billion LTE-related subscriptions.
MTS Picks Ericsson for LTE Network Development
Russia’s mobile operator Mobile TeleSystems (MTS) has selected Ericsson to deploy the LTE network in four regions covering more than half of Russia. Under the three-year agreement and starting in Q2, 2013, Ericsson will roll out LTE in the Siberian, Ural, Volga, and Southern Federal Districts of Russia.
